Step 6: Deploy Bellchart, the timetable solver, to the Marrowfield cluster. Verify the constraint-engine binary hash matches the build record. Confirm sandbox flags are enabled and the solver has no outbound network access. The deployment manifest must be signed before the admission controller will schedule it. Sign the manifest with the key below.

deploy key for kajof-fajop: bky6_gDHw9Q

Ticket: Staging env misconfigured for Siftgate bloom filter

The bloom layer in front of the Pellet KV store is rejecting all lookups in staging because the env file was copied from the dev template without credentials. False-positive tuning values are fine; only the auth line is missing. To unblock the weekly demo, the Pellet admission secret must be set on the following line.

env line for yaguf-fajop: LEDGER_TOKEN13=fb08984397349

Checklist item for the Farelark pricing experiment: security sign-off needed before we flip the flag. Quick asks — confirm the experiment bucket assignment doesn't leak into analytics exports, check the discount cap can't be overridden client-side, and make sure rollback kills in-flight sessions cleanly. Nothing scary, but eyes on it please. The experiment build token you should verify against is right below.

session token of tajef-bageg = htk21_5d90d574934f3ccae6437

Ticket #— Floor 9 Opening Prep, Brindlemoor House

Hi facilities folks, Floor 9 opens to staff next Monday and we need a few things squared away before then. Lift access is live, but the two side doors by the kitchenette are still on the old lock config — please reprogram them before Friday. Also, signage for the quiet rooms hasn't arrived, so pop up the temporary printed ones for now. Until the badge readers sync, the interim door code for Floor 9 is below.

door code, bajop-bajog: bdg-DSWAC-43621

Quick note on SketchPond's undo stack: each diagram op averages ~2KB, and power users hit 500+ ops per session, so we're capping history and compacting older entries to keep tabs under 50MB. Redo shares the same buffer, so no extra cost there. The caps I'd like you to sanity-check are right below.

tuning table, yajog-yahof:
BUDGETS = {
    "lamvan": 303,
    "wenox": 460,
    "fenvan": 525,
}